MoWest Social Work Program to host annual Walk for the Homeless
ST. JOSEPH, Mo. (News-Press NOW) -- Missouri Western State University's Social Work Program will host and sponsor an annual Downtown tradition to raise awareness for St. Joseph's homeless population.
The 14th Annual Walk for the Homeless will take place at 4:30 p.m. on Friday, Nov. 7, in Downtown St. Joseph at 6th and Messanie Streets, next to the Downtown Health Center.
Check-in will begin at 4 p.m. The event is open to the public and it's free to walk, but participants are encouraged to purchase an event t-shirt for $20. Proceeds will benefit the Downtown Health Center's Homeless Fund.

Walkers will follow the migration path the homeless take through Downtown to access services designed to meet their basic needs.
All money collected will help the homeless population in the St. Joseph area with costs for birth certificates, IDs, job searches and miscellaneous needs.
